So we have less than 9 hours before we should get Cliff Avril signed to a long term deal or let him decide whether to sign the one year tender and play it out and hit the FA market next year. Avril wants the Lions to show him the money and the Lions don't think he is worth whatever he is asking. But if you look back, we had the exact situation in the past when other Lions were tagged. Both Jeff Backus and Cory Redding were tagged but signed up long term contracts just minutes before the deadline. The cliche is that this happened during the Millen regime.
The Lions have half their defense entering FA next year and most of them are key players or rotation players. They need to focus on getting them in the fold as well. While they don't believe Avril is worth what he is asking, the cap relief that signing him brings up will help signing at least a couple of up coming FA players from the team to long term as an inherent benefit.
